Skip to content

Commit 48cf85e

Browse files
upgrade selfupdate package
1 parent f177173 commit 48cf85e

File tree

3 files changed

+8
-3
lines changed

3 files changed

+8
-3
lines changed

go.mod

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,7 @@ require (
66
github.com/adrg/xdg v0.2.2
77
github.com/capnspacehook/taskmaster v0.0.0-20190802050140-eebf732b5748
88
github.com/creativeprojects/clog v0.7.0
9-
github.com/creativeprojects/go-selfupdate v0.1.1
9+
github.com/creativeprojects/go-selfupdate v0.2.0
1010
github.com/fsnotify/fsnotify v1.4.9 // indirect
1111
github.com/kr/text v0.2.0 // indirect
1212
github.com/mackerelio/go-osstat v0.1.0

go.sum

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-74,6 +74,8 @@ github.com/creativeprojects/clog v0.7.0 h1:DjSsrio8qycU/EbXBxg+48ag7hQUC+sw6HPNc
7474
github.com/creativeprojects/clog v0.7.0/go.mod h1:lKHYfKKFcYIWzOAyYnajhzDuRdhsMDEtHW1p3/ScFNg=
7575
github.com/creativeprojects/go-selfupdate v0.1.1 h1:r5sWo8Q8YgXh8atKU0RQIfDKNeu6SIn2AvsYJ3SipUs=
7676
github.com/creativeprojects/go-selfupdate v0.1.1/go.mod h1:NyVuo4vfPNDDiTi7Wl94LzV7UccxmpmrP8bvPj+nc74=
77+
github.com/creativeprojects/go-selfupdate v0.2.0 h1:o/jO4LwFKLizj+KS2aLcQB4JAopLG/s0a4oFim7/86g=
78+
github.com/creativeprojects/go-selfupdate v0.2.0/go.mod h1:vLr7NcgJsWiGkQSWbJ3IPjhSFiKP0HoMapNngShqqzc=
7779
github.com/davecgh/go-spew v1.1.0/go.mod h1:J7Y8YcW2NihsgmVo/mv3lAwl/skON4iLHjSsI+c5H38=
7880
github.com/davecgh/go-spew v1.1.1 h1:vj9j/u1bqnvCEfJOwUhtlOARqs3+rkHYY13jYWTU97c=
7981
github.com/davecgh/go-spew v1.1.1/go.mod h1:J7Y8YcW2NihsgmVo/mv3lAwl/skON4iLHjSsI+c5H38=
@@ -414,6 +416,7 @@ golang.org/x/net v0.0.0-20200707034311-ab3426394381/go.mod h1:/O7V0waA8r7cgGh81R
414416
golang.org/x/net v0.0.0-20200822124328-c89045814202 h1:VvcQYSHwXgi7W+TpUR6A9g6Up98WAHf3f/ulnJ62IyA=
415417
golang.org/x/net v0.0.0-20200822124328-c89045814202/go.mod h1:/O7V0waA8r7cgGh81Ro3o1hOxt32SMVPicZroKQ2sZA=
416418
golang.org/x/net v0.0.0-20201006153459-a7d1128ccaa0/go.mod h1:sp8m0HH+o8qH0wwXwYZr8TS3Oi6o0r6Gce1SSxlDquU=
419+
golang.org/x/net v0.0.0-20201021035429-f5854403a974/go.mod h1:sp8m0HH+o8qH0wwXwYZr8TS3Oi6o0r6Gce1SSxlDquU=
417420
golang.org/x/net v0.0.0-20201031054903-ff519b6c9102 h1:42cLlJJdEh+ySyeUUbEQ5bsTiq8voBeTuweGVkY6Puw=
418421
golang.org/x/net v0.0.0-20201031054903-ff519b6c9102/go.mod h1:sp8m0HH+o8qH0wwXwYZr8TS3Oi6o0r6Gce1SSxlDquU=
419422
golang.org/x/oauth2 v0.0.0-20180821212333-d2e6202438be/go.mod h1:N/0e6XlmueqKjAGxoOufVs8QHGRruUQn6yWY3a++T0U=
@@ -424,6 +427,8 @@ golang.org/x/oauth2 v0.0.0-20200107190931-bf48bf16ab8d h1:TzXSXBo42m9gQenoE3b9BG
424427
golang.org/x/oauth2 v0.0.0-20200107190931-bf48bf16ab8d/go.mod h1:gOpvHmFTYa4IltrdGE7lF6nIHvwfUNPOp7c8zoXwtLw=
425428
golang.org/x/oauth2 v0.0.0-20200902213428-5d25da1a8d43 h1:ld7aEMNHoBnnDAX15v1T6z31v8HwR2A9FYOuAhWqkwc=
426429
golang.org/x/oauth2 v0.0.0-20200902213428-5d25da1a8d43/go.mod h1:KelEdhl1UZF7XfJ4dDtk6s++YSgaE7mD/BuKKDLBl4A=
430+
golang.org/x/oauth2 v0.0.0-20201109201403-9fd604954f58 h1:Mj83v+wSRNEar42a/MQgxk9X42TdEmrOl9i+y8WbxLo=
431+
golang.org/x/oauth2 v0.0.0-20201109201403-9fd604954f58/go.mod h1:KelEdhl1UZF7XfJ4dDtk6s++YSgaE7mD/BuKKDLBl4A=
427432
golang.org/x/sync v0.0.0-20180314180146-1d60e4601c6f/go.mod h1:RxMgew5VJxzue5/jJTE5uejpjVlOe/izrB70Jof72aM=
428433
golang.org/x/sync v0.0.0-20181108010431-42b317875d0f/go.mod h1:RxMgew5VJxzue5/jJTE5uejpjVlOe/izrB70Jof72aM=
429434
golang.org/x/sync v0.0.0-20181221193216-37e7f081c4d4/go.mod h1:RxMgew5VJxzue5/jJTE5uejpjVlOe/izrB70Jof72aM=

update.go

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-23,7 +23,7 @@ func confirmAndSelfUpdate(debug bool) error {
2323
return fmt.Errorf("latest version for %s/%s could not be found from github repository", runtime.GOOS, runtime.GOARCH)
2424
}
2525

26-
if latest.LessThan(version) {
26+
if latest.LessOrEqual(version) {
2727
clog.Infof("Current version (%s) is the latest", version)
2828
return nil
2929
}
@@ -40,6 +40,6 @@ func confirmAndSelfUpdate(debug bool) error {
4040
if err := selfupdate.UpdateTo(latest.AssetURL, exe); err != nil {
4141
return fmt.Errorf("error occurred while updating binary: %v", err)
4242
}
43-
clog.Infof("Successfully updated to version %s", latest.Version)
43+
clog.Infof("Successfully updated to version %s", latest.Version())
4444
return nil
4545
}

0 commit comments

Comments
 (0)